The tour usually starts with travelers taking the elevator up the Eiffel Tower. As they ascend, the vast beauty of Paris unfolds beneath them, providing panoramic views of iconic sites like the Seine River, Notre-Dame Cathedral, and the Louvre Museum.
Learn About the Tower’s History :
During the ascent, a knowledgeable guide often shares insights about the history and significance of the Eiffel Tower. From its construction for the 1889 World’s Fair to its status as a global symbol of Paris, visitors learn about the tower’s cultural and architectural importance.
